Red Emperor Says Drilling Rig Ready To Drill Hawkeye-1 In Philippines

30th Jul 2015 08:22

LONDON (Alliance News) - Red Emperor Resources NL Thursday said the Maersk Venturer drilling rig has arrived at the SC55 licence area offshore the Philippines in preparation for the drilling of the Hawkeye-1 well.

The well will be drilled over 23 days by the drilling rig as has been designed to reach the top of target reservoir approximately 1,000 metres below the sea bed floor and intersect the gas oil contact to prove or otherwise the presence of the oil leg, said the company.

Red Emperor acquired a 15% stake in the license block and well in March after signing a farm-in agreement with the subsidiary of Australia's Otto Energy Ltd, Otto Energy Philippines.

Red Emperor shares were up 1.1% to 4.72 pence per share on Thursday morning.
